Keeping the Layout Open and Airy

One of the most important principles in small living room design is maintaining an open layout. Avoid placing bulky furniture that blocks pathways or makes the room feel cramped.

Using fewer but well-chosen pieces helps create a sense of space. Keeping the layout simple allows for better flow and movement.

An open layout makes the room feel larger and more comfortable.

Choosing the Right Furniture Size

Furniture should be proportionate to the size of the room. Oversized sofas or large tables can overwhelm a small space.

Opting for compact sofas, slim chairs, and lightweight tables helps maintain balance. Furniture with exposed legs can also create a more open visual effect.

Choosing the right size ensures comfort without overcrowding.

Using Multi-Functional Pieces

Multi-functional furniture is essential in small living rooms. Storage ottomans, nesting tables, or sofa beds can provide additional functionality without requiring extra space.

These pieces help maximize usability while keeping the layout efficient.

Functional furniture supports both practicality and design.

Incorporating Light Colors and Textures

Light colors can make a room feel brighter and more open. Neutral tones such as white, beige, or soft gray reflect light and enhance the sense of space.

Adding textures through fabrics and decor helps create depth without overwhelming the design.

A balanced color palette improves both comfort and aesthetics.

Using Mirrors to Expand the Space

Mirrors are one of the most effective tools for making small living rooms feel larger. They reflect light and create the illusion of depth.

Placing a mirror across from a window can enhance natural light and brighten the space.

Mirrors improve both functionality and visual appeal.

Creating Zones in Compact Spaces

Even in small living rooms, creating zones can improve functionality. A seating area, reading corner, or small workspace can be defined using furniture placement or rugs.

This helps organize the space and prevents it from feeling cluttered.

Defined zones make the room more efficient and usable.

Keeping Decor Minimal and Intentional

Minimal decor works best in small spaces. A few carefully chosen pieces can add personality without overwhelming the room.

Avoid over-accessorizing and focus on items that complement the overall design.

Intentional decor keeps the space clean and balanced.

Maintaining Clear Circulation

Clear pathways are essential in small living rooms. Furniture should be arranged in a way that allows easy movement throughout the space.

Avoid placing large pieces in high-traffic areas.

Good circulation improves both comfort and usability.
